Ready to blast off the night with some festive fireworks in Georgia? Before you grab those sparklers and rockets, it's important to understand the state's rules on launching pyrotechnics. Georgia offers a balance of legal fireworks options while ensuring the safety of residents and property. This detailed guide will walk you through the key points of celebrating responsibly with fireworks in Georgia.
- Be aware of the specific types of fireworks allowed in Georgia.
- Respect local ordinances and regulations, as some cities or counties may have stricter rules.
- Prioritize safety by following proper handling and lighting procedures.
- Refrain from using fireworks near dry grass, trees, or structures.
- Be sure to always have a bucket of water or a hose nearby in case of emergencies.

Ready to light up the night with dazzling shows of fireworks this year? Before you grab those sparklers, it's crucial to understand the laws surrounding fireworks in Georgia. While some kinds of fireworks are legal, others are strictly prohibited. Make sure to explore local ordinances and state restrictions to avoid any mishaps.
Safety should always be your top priority. Always launch fireworks outdoors in best fireworks store in georgia a clear area away from houses. Never allow kids to handle fireworks without adult supervision. Keep a bucket of water or a hose nearby to quickly extinguish any unintended flames.
To ensure you're purchasing legal and safe fireworks, choose reputable vendors. Look for certificates indicating compliance with safety standards. Remember, your party should be a memorable one filled with joy, not accidents.
